There is not yet a genuine crisis in Russia-Armenia relations because the discourse against Armenia from Moscow comes from Foreign Minister Lavrov, spokesperson Peskov, and lower-level officials, not Vladimir Putin himself, indicating the issue has not reached Putin's personal attention level.
